The SOPine Clusterboard is a way to setup a compact cluster for low power usage and testing.&lt;br /&gt;
It can hold up to 7 SOPine modules.&lt;br /&gt;
&lt;br /&gt;
Although there is a [[PINE_A64-LTS/SOPine]] page already, this page will describe both the Clusterboard and the SOPine modules.&lt;br /&gt;
&lt;br /&gt;
There is a user guide on the [https://forum.pine64.org/showthread.php?tid=7077 forum] but sadly the images have disappeared.&lt;br /&gt;
&lt;br /&gt;
While the Cluster board is an hardware open source project, please note that it does not mean this project is &amp;quot;OSH&amp;quot; compliant.&lt;br /&gt;
&lt;br /&gt;
==Specifications==&lt;br /&gt;
These are the specifications as mentioned in the project [https://www.pine64.org/clusterboard/ introduction]: (spellchecked a bit)&lt;br /&gt;
*Standard mITX Form-Factor (167mm x 170mm)&lt;br /&gt;
*Built-In Unmanaged Gigabit Ethernet Switch - RTL8370N&lt;br /&gt;
*7x RTL8211E Gigabit Ethernet port, connected to the Switch&lt;br /&gt;
*eMMC module Slot&lt;br /&gt;
*7x USB 2.0 (one for each module)&lt;br /&gt;
*GPIO pins exposed for each module including UART&lt;br /&gt;
*NIC LEDs for each SOPine Module&lt;br /&gt;
*2x 1.5V “AA” size Battery Holder for Real Time Clock Port (RTC)&lt;br /&gt;
*+5V 15A power supply with 6.3mm OD/3.0mm ID barrel type DC Jack&lt;br /&gt;
*ATX Power Supply Header&lt;br /&gt;

==Accessories==&lt;br /&gt;
*To operate this board you will need a power supply, Pine advises a &amp;quot;5V 15A power supply with 6.3mm OD/3.0mm ID barrel type DC Jack&amp;quot; which is also available in the store ([https://pine64.com/product/clusterboard-eu-power-supply/ EU]/[https://pine64.com/product/clusterboard-us-power-supply/ US] versions). There are other ways to power this board, but they are not described here yet.&lt;br /&gt;
*The board works best when it is protected by a (mITX)case, and has some airflow provided by a fan.  &lt;br /&gt;
*Each SOPine module can use cooling, both by a casefan, and by using heatsinks on the individual modules. At least the A64 could use some cooling.&lt;br /&gt;
*The first slot can use a eMMC module, which are in the store in [https://pine64.com/product/16gb-emmc-module/ 16GB]/[https://pine64.com/product/32gb-emmc-module/ 32GB]/[https://pine64.com/product/64gb-emmc-module/ 64GB]/[https://pine64.com/product/128gb-emmc-module/ 128GB] sizes. The modules can be used as a USB stick using a [https://pine64.com/product/usb-adapter-for-emmc-module/ USB adapter]. (The eMMC is also readable with the Hardkernel [https://www.hardkernel.com/shop/emmc-module-reader-board-for-os-upgrade/ eMMC to microSD] converter.)&lt;br /&gt;
*2x AA batteries, to allow the SOPine nodes to retain the RTC (Real Time Clock) time and date information when the power is disconnected.&lt;br /&gt;
&lt;br /&gt;
==Installation==&lt;br /&gt;
To install this cluster it is important to know which module has which IP address, so you can make sure you connect to the right board, esp with the module that has access to the eMMC.&lt;br /&gt;
&lt;br /&gt;
You can plug in each module individually, and give them a separate name. After that is taken care of you will know which module is used for what. It would also be possible to manually edit each images hosts/hostname files before first boot.&lt;br /&gt;
&lt;br /&gt;
{{hint|1=The board has no hotplug functionality, so make sure you only plug/unplug the modules while the power is disconnected from the clusterboard.}}&lt;br /&gt;
{{hint|1=As a unmanaged switch is used there is no VLAN support.}}&lt;br /&gt;
&lt;br /&gt;
===Serial console===&lt;br /&gt;
To boot use the serial console connect the pins to UART0 on the GPIO header and connect using baud 115200&lt;br /&gt;
&lt;br /&gt;
* Pin 6: GND&lt;br /&gt;
* Pin 7: RTX&lt;br /&gt;
* Pin 8: TXD&lt;br /&gt;
&lt;br /&gt;
The pinouts are available in the [https://forum.pine64.org/showthread.php?tid=8058 forum].&lt;br /&gt;
&lt;br /&gt;
{{hint|1=Do not connect the GND connector until the power is on as it can provide power and prevent the board from booting}}&lt;br /&gt;
&lt;br /&gt;
==Operating systems==&lt;br /&gt;
===Armbian===&lt;br /&gt;
To get the cluster running, start off with a basic [https://www.armbian.com/sopine-a64/ Armbian SOPine] install on the first module or directly on all the modules. Armbian offers Debian and Ubuntu as options for download.&lt;br /&gt;
&lt;br /&gt;
There is an issue recognizing the network that needs you to make a change to the base image described [https://forum.pine64.org/showthread.php?tid=10432 here], and a PXE issue. If you have a good description, please add it here. The network issue should have been resolved in Armbian builds post December 2020 - [https://github.com/armbian/build/pull/2396 as described here] - but confirmation from an affected user is needed.&lt;br /&gt;
&lt;br /&gt;
There are a number of possible basic installation methods.&lt;br /&gt;
*Full install on each module's mSD card.&lt;br /&gt;
*eMMC install on the first module.&lt;br /&gt;
*PXE boot for all modules, from the first module, or an external host.&lt;br /&gt;
&lt;br /&gt;
==Frequently asked questions==&lt;br /&gt;
Q: Are the individual MAC addresses linked to the NIC, or the module.&lt;br /&gt;
&lt;br /&gt;
A: The MAC address is specific to the SOPine module - swapping modules within the Clusterboard does not change the address of the module &lt;br /&gt;

&lt;div&gt;The SOEdge is a 3TOPS compute module that can be paired with the SOPine base board or USB 3.0 and PCIe adapters for development. It can connect to a SBC, such as the ROCKPro64 or a regular PC. &lt;br /&gt;

== SoC and Memory Specification ==&lt;br /&gt;
* Based on [https://www.rock-chips.com/a/en/products/RK18_Series/2019/0529/989.html Rockchip RK1808]&lt;br /&gt;
[[File:RK1808_icon.png|right]]&lt;br /&gt;
&lt;br /&gt;
=== CPU Architecture ===&lt;br /&gt;
* [https://developer.arm.com/ip-products/processors/cortex-a/cortex-a35 Dual-core ARM Cortex-A35 Processor@1600-2000Mhz]&lt;br /&gt;
* A power-efficient ARM 64-Bit Armv8-A architecture&lt;br /&gt;
* AArch32 for full backward compatibility with Armv7&lt;br /&gt;
* Support NEON Advanced SIMD (Single Instruction Multiple Data) instruction for acceleration of media and signal processing function&lt;br /&gt;
* Support Large Physical Address Extensions(LPAE)&lt;br /&gt;
* VFPv4 Floating Point Unit&lt;br /&gt;
* 32KB L1 Instruction cache and 32KB L1 Data cache&lt;br /&gt;
* AArch64 for 64-bit support and new architectural features&lt;br /&gt;
* TrustZone security technology&lt;br /&gt;
* Neon Advanced SIMD&lt;br /&gt;
* DSP and SIMD extensions&lt;br /&gt;
* VFPv4 Floating point&lt;br /&gt;
* Hardware virtualization support&lt;br /&gt;
* 128KB L2 cache&lt;br /&gt;
&lt;br /&gt;
&lt;br /&gt;
=== Neural Process Unit NPU Capability ===&lt;br /&gt;
* [https://www.verisilicon.com/en/IPPortfolio/VivanteNPUIP NPU IP from Verisilicon Vivante]&lt;br /&gt;
* Support max 1920 Int8 MAC operation per cycle&lt;br /&gt;
* Support max192 Int16 MAC operation per cycle&lt;br /&gt;
* Support max 64 FP16 MAC operation per cycle&lt;br /&gt;
* 512KB internal buffer&lt;br /&gt;
* One isolated voltage domain to support DVFS&lt;br /&gt;

&lt;div&gt;You can install Veracrypt on the Pinebook Pro, but you have to (at this time) compile it from source.&lt;br /&gt;
This is how to do it,&lt;br /&gt;
You need to install the following packages:-&lt;br /&gt;
&lt;br /&gt;
sudo pacman -Syu --asdeps&lt;br /&gt;
gcc&lt;br /&gt;
binutils&lt;br /&gt;
fakeroot&lt;br /&gt;
yasm&lt;br /&gt;
wxgtk3&lt;br /&gt;
patch&lt;br /&gt;
asp&lt;br /&gt;
make&lt;br /&gt;
pkgconfig&lt;br /&gt;
&lt;br /&gt;
Create a new folder and cd into it.&lt;br /&gt;
&lt;br /&gt;
asp checkout veracrypt&lt;br /&gt;
&lt;br /&gt;
cd into the folder with the PKGBUILD (./veracrypt/trunk)&lt;br /&gt;
&lt;br /&gt;
makepkg --ignorearch --skippgpcheck&lt;br /&gt;
&lt;br /&gt;
If you are in luck  you will find this file appearing in the trunk folder&lt;br /&gt;
&lt;br /&gt;
veracrypt-1.24.update4-1-aarch64.pkg.tar.xz&lt;br /&gt;
&lt;br /&gt;
you can install it with this command&lt;br /&gt;
&lt;br /&gt;
sudo pamac install veracrypt-1.24.update4-1-aarch64.pkg.tar.xz&lt;br /&gt;

== Description ==&lt;br /&gt;
The PineBook Pro's docking station was custom designed for both physical dimensions and ports to compliment the PineBook Pro laptop. While it may work for other laptops, convergence devices, (tablets and smart phones), it has not been tested on such.&lt;br /&gt;
== Ports available ==&lt;br /&gt;
List of ports available on docking station:&lt;br /&gt;
* USB 3.0 Ports x3&lt;br /&gt;
* USB-C Ports 2x&lt;br /&gt;
* 4K @ 30fps HDMI x1&lt;br /&gt;
* 1080P VGA x1&lt;br /&gt;
* Gigabit Ethernet networking port x 1&lt;br /&gt;
* Card readers: micro SD x 1 &amp;amp; SD x 1, supports: SD, SDHC and SDXC&lt;br /&gt;
* Audio Jack: 3.5mm Earphone Jack with mic x1&lt;br /&gt;
== Chips used ==&lt;br /&gt;
List of chips used in the docking station:&lt;br /&gt;
* PD Negotiation chip - PDFL7102&lt;br /&gt;
* HDMI/VGA chip - IT6564&lt;br /&gt;
* GbE Ethernet chip - RTL8153B&lt;br /&gt;
* USB 3.0 Hub chip - VL817&lt;br /&gt;
* SD card reader chip - GL823K&lt;br /&gt;
* Audio CODEC chip - HZD100&lt;br /&gt;

=== Official Debian Installer Images ===&lt;br /&gt;
* Uses only the upstream kernel and firmware without special patches&lt;br /&gt;
* No graphical display yet, works only through serial console&lt;br /&gt;
* Requires adding the non-free component to your /etc/apt/sources.list file and installing the &amp;quot;firmware-linux&amp;quot; package for Wi-Fi and Bluetooth support&lt;br /&gt;
* Installer is loaded into RAM, can install onto the same media from which it’s booted&lt;br /&gt;
* Supports automatic partitioning and full disk encryption through LVM&lt;br /&gt;
* Installer currently doesn't install the bootloader, leaving the installed system in an unbootable state until it's manually added&lt;br /&gt;
&lt;br /&gt;
[https://d-i.debian.org/daily-images/arm64/daily/netboot/SD-card-images/ The relevant files are built daily here] and may sometimes be unavailable if the build system is having issues. The &amp;quot;README.concatenateable_images&amp;quot; file provides instructions on how to combine the partition.img.gz file with the firmware.pinebook-pro.rk3399.img.gz file in order to create a DD-able image.&lt;br /&gt;
&lt;br /&gt;
The official images are '''not''' recommended yet until the display begins working and the installer properly installs the bootloader. Most users will want to see [[Pinebook Pro Debian Installer|Daniel Thompson's Debian Installer]] instead.&lt;br /&gt;
